My recommndation to you is go wtih regular flybar heli. Learn to fly and set it up proper. Flybarless will be easier to fly, but flybarless setup can be tricky for newer pilots and IMO if you want to get good(which I'm not), you should learn to fly and make the proper corrections and I think it will only help you later even if you decide to go FBL later.
For parts recommendations for the 90
Motor: YS91SR or OS91HZ
pipe Outrage 90 for appropriate motor
cyclic Servos: Align DS610's(budget choice), better would be Futaba BLS252, JR 8717, Outrage new coreless or brushless yet to be released
Tail servo: Outrage BLS tail
Gyro Spartan DS760 or quark, Inertia 860
Gov: Curtis ATG v3, or Aerospire Multigov pro
Blades: General flying and 3d, Radix 690 or 710SB, 3d-can't say for sure yet as I haven't flown heli. Guessing Align 690D, SAB 690(new red/white/black), Mavrikk 690 G5 pro, Radix 690SB
